Day 4 :
Early in the morning and carrying only your coat and the photo camera we overcome
the Chorrillo Salt, always with the impressive needles of the glacier in front of
us. The first 2 hours are mainly flat, through forest and open glade and bog areas,
with diverse bird life, lead us to Fitz Roy base camp. From here it is a 400
meters/1300 ft climb to the De los Tres lagoon on a steep trail that takes us around
one hour and a half at gentle pace. This walk is one of the highlights in the
National Park Los Glaciares; the views of Cerro Poincenot, Monte Fitz Roy and the
other peaks surrounding these are splendid. We return to Capri Lagoon Full Camp.
(5 hs approx) BLD
Day 5 :
This morning we hike surrounding Capri Lagoon down by the trail to Madre e Hija
Lagoons through a dense forest following the Fitz Roy River. We reach the Mount
Torre Valley to glacier-fed Laguna Torre where Fitz Roy river begins. This lagoon
contained between moraines, generally piles floes that come off of the Grande
Glacier that falls in its west extreme. The impressive group of Mount Torre needles
with its slender 3128 meters/10262 ft height, frame the landscape. BLD

Day 8 :
After breakfast we depart by bus to the Magallanes peninsula, where is located the
entrance of The Glaciers National Park. Its centerpiece is the Perito Moreno Glacier,
which, because of unusually favorable local conditions, is one of the world`s few
advancing glaciers. Huge icebergs from the glacier wall collapse into the De los
Tempanos Channel. The roar of the gigantic ice rocks falling and crashing into the
waters of the channel is a unique experience.
Our bus will lead us just in front of the Glacier, allowing us to walk the gangplanks
to view the Glacier from different viewpoints.
Then we go down to the lakeside to board a ship that carries us very near the Glacier
ice walls. We return to El Calafate using a different route that we used to arrive.
B

Day 10 :
We dedicate this day to one of the most spectacular and classical trekking in the
park: the Torres Trail. We transfer after breakfast by bus to the trail start at
Las Torres area. We cross a suspended bridge and remount the slopes of the Almirante
Nieto Mount, bordering the Ascencio River. After one hour ascending we go into
the Valley, and reach Chileno Refuge. From there the trail leads us through the
forest, in the middle of unforgettable landscapes, to Las Torres base camp. There
the climbers wait good weather conditions to climb Las Torres. We trek one hour more
to reach the Las Torres Viewpoint, an amazing natural amphitheater at the bottom of
the vertical granite towers that reach 2800 meters height. We return by the same
way. It`s a total 7-hour trek. BLD
Day 11 :
Early in the morning we cross sailing 45 minutes the Pehoe Lake embarking at puerto
Pudeto and arriving at the Pehoe Refuge area. We walk from there until get the Del
Frances Valley. It`s a beautiful mountain valley descending from the middle of the
massif toward the Nordenskjold Lake. Flanked by The Horns to the east and by the
impressive Paine Grande (3050 meters/10006 ft) to the west. We ascend the valley
until the upper viewpoints located in a natural amphitheater surrounded by some
of needles and walls most wonderful of the massif: Cuernos, Espada, Mascara, Hoja,
Aleta de Tiburon, Catedral, and Paine Grande. The forest and the suspended glaciers
that cause continuous ice and snow fallings, give us a unique scenery to this walk.
We descend the same trail and turn west rounding Skottberg Lake until arrive to
our Camp for this night at Pehoe Refuge area. It`s a total 7-hour trek. BLD
Day 12 :
Another unforgettable day dedicated to the Grey Glacier, impressive Glacier 300
square kilometers of surface (115 square miles), 25 kilometers long (16 miles).
It overflows from the Continental Ice Field falling into Grey Lake. The Glacier
produce enormous amount of blue icebergs that sail over the lake pushed by the
wind toward the south, given the characteristic feature to this lake.
The trail leads us to a wonderful viewpoint where we can appreciate the whole lake,
the glacier and the mountains that emerge from the west of the Ice Field.
Two more hours walking and we arrive to another viewpoint just in front of the
Glacier.
All the trek is develop between Andean bush and lengas forest, at the shadow of
the ice blocks that drape the Paine Grande Mount. We walk this day about 7 hours.
At the end of the day we sail again the Pehoe Lake to the south shore to return to
our Full Camp at Camping Pehoe area. BLD
